Quoted:
I really like the scar. It really looks tacti cool as well. I wonder if it is going to as reliable as the Hk 416 (It does use gas piston sooo)?


The US Army conducted a test at the request of the Congress that is often called the "Dust Test."  The SCAR L outperformed the HK 416 with only 226 failures out of 10,000 rounds fired while the HK 416 had 233 failures.  The M4 had a total of 882 failures out of 10,000 rounds fired.
